IN NO EVENT SHALL THE COPYRIGHT +// OWNER OR CONTRIBUTORS BE L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, +// S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T NOT +// L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, +// D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Y +// TH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T +// (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E +// O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. + +#include <windows.h> + +#include <fstream> +#include <iostream> + +#include "base/base_paths.h" +#include "base/file_util.h" +#include "base/logging.h" +#include "base/path_service.h" +#include "base/process_util.h" +#include "base/scoped_ptr.h" +#include "base/string_util.h" +#include "chrome/installer/util/delete_tree_work_item.h" +#include "chrome/installer/util/work_item.h" +#include "testing/gtest/include/gtest/gtest.h" + +namespace { + class DeleteTreeWorkItemTest : public testing::Test { + protected: + virtual void SetUp() { + // Name a subdirectory of the user temp directory. + ASSERT_TRUE(PathService::Get(base::DIR_TEMP, &test_dir_)); + file_util::AppendToPath(&test_dir_, L"DeleteTreeWorkItemTest"); + + // Create a fresh, empty copy of this test directory. + file_util::Delete(test_dir_, true); + CreateDirectory(test_dir_.c_str(), NULL); + + ASSERT_TRUE(file_util::PathExists(test_dir_)); + } + + virtual void TearDown() { + // Clean up test directory + ASSERT_TRUE(file_util::Delete(test_dir_, false)); + ASSERT_FALSE(file_util::PathExists(test_dir_)); + } + + // the path to temporary directory used to contain the test operations + std::wstring test_dir_; + }; + + // Simple function to dump some text into a new file. + void CreateTextFile(const std::wstring& filename, + const std::wstring& contents) { + std::ofstream file; + file.open(filename.c_str()); + ASSERT_TRUE(file.is_open()); + file << contents; + file.close(); + } + + wchar_t text_content_1[] = L"delete me"; + wchar_t text_content_2[] = L"delete me as well"; +}; + +// Delete a tree without key path. Everything should be deleted. +TEST_F(DeleteTreeWorkItemTest, DeleteTreeNoKeyPath) { + // Create tree to be deleted + std::wstring dir_name_delete(test_dir_); + file_util::AppendToPath(&dir_name_delete, L"to_be_delete"); + CreateDirectory(dir_name_delete.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ete)); + + std::wstring dir_name_delete_1(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_1, L"1"); + CreateDirectory(dir_name_delete_1.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_1)); + + std::wstring dir_name_delete_2(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_2, L"2"); + CreateDirectory(dir_name_delete_2.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_2)); + + std::wstring file_name_delete_1(dir_name_delete_1); + file_util::AppendToPath(&file_name_delete_1, L"File_1.txt"); + CreateTextFile(file_name_delete_1,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_1)); + + std::wstring file_name_delete_2(dir_name_delete_2); + file_util::AppendToPath(&file_name_delete_2, L"File_2.txt"); + CreateTextFile(file_name_delete_2,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_2)); + + // test Do() + scoped_ptr<DeleteTreeWorkItem> work_item( + WorkItem::CreateDeleteTreeWorkItem(dir_name_delete, std::wstring())); + EXPECT_TRUE(work_item->Do()); + + // everything should be gone + EXPECT_FALSE(file_util::PathExists(file_name_delete_1)); + EXPECT_FALSE(file_util::PathExists(file_name_delete_2)); + EXPECT_FALSE(file_util::PathExists(dir_name_delete)); + + work_item->Rollback(); + // everything should come back + EXPECT_TRUE(file_util::PathExists(file_name_delete_1)); + EXPECT_TRUE(file_util::PathExists(file_name_delete_2)); + EXPECT_TRUE(file_util::PathExists(dir_name_delete)); +} + + +// Delete a tree with keypath but not in use. Everything should be gone. +// Rollback should bring back everything +TEST_F(DeleteTreeWorkItemTest, DeleteTree) { + // Create tree to be deleted + std::wstring dir_name_delete(test_dir_); + file_util::AppendToPath(&dir_name_delete, L"to_be_delete"); + CreateDirectory(dir_name_delete.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ete)); + + std::wstring dir_name_delete_1(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_1, L"1"); + CreateDirectory(dir_name_delete_1.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_1)); + + std::wstring dir_name_delete_2(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_2, L"2"); + CreateDirectory(dir_name_delete_2.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_2)); + + std::wstring file_name_delete_1(dir_name_delete_1); + file_util::AppendToPath(&file_name_delete_1, L"File_1.txt"); + CreateTextFile(file_name_delete_1,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_1)); + + std::wstring file_name_delete_2(dir_name_delete_2); + file_util::AppendToPath(&file_name_delete_2, L"File_2.txt"); + CreateTextFile(file_name_delete_2,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_2)); + + // test Do() + scoped_ptr<DeleteTreeWorkItem> work_item( + WorkItem::CreateDeleteTreeWorkItem(dir_name_delete, file_name_delete_1)); + EXPECT_TRUE(work_item->Do()); + + // everything should be gone + EXPECT_FALSE(file_util::PathExists(file_name_delete_1)); + EXPECT_FALSE(file_util::PathExists(file_name_delete_2)); + EXPECT_FALSE(file_util::PathExists(dir_name_delete)); + + work_item->Rollback(); + // everything should come back + EXPECT_TRUE(file_util::PathExists(file_name_delete_1)); + EXPECT_TRUE(file_util::PathExists(file_name_delete_2)); + EXPECT_TRUE(file_util::PathExists(dir_name_delete)); +} + +// Delete a tree with key_path in use. Everything should still be there. +TEST_F(DeleteTreeWorkItemTest, DeleteTreeInUse) { + // Create tree to be deleted + std::wstring dir_name_delete(test_dir_); + file_util::AppendToPath(&dir_name_delete, L"to_be_delete"); + CreateDirectory(dir_name_delete.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ete)); + + std::wstring dir_name_delete_1(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_1, L"1"); + CreateDirectory(dir_name_delete_1.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_1)); + + std::wstring dir_name_delete_2(dir_name_delete); + file_util::AppendToPath(&dir_name_delete_2, L"2"); + CreateDirectory(dir_name_delete_2.c_str(), NULL); + ASSERT_TRUE(file_util::PathExists(dir_name_delete_2)); + + std::wstring file_name_delete_1(dir_name_delete_1); + file_util::AppendToPath(&file_name_delete_1, L"File_1.txt"); + CreateTextFile(file_name_delete_1,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_1)); + + std::wstring file_name_delete_2(dir_name_delete_2); + file_util::AppendToPath(&file_name_delete_2, L"File_2.txt"); + CreateTextFile(file_name_delete_2, text_content_1); + ASSERT_TRUE(file_util::PathExists(file_name_delete_2)); + + // Create a key path file. + std::wstring key_path(dir_name_delete); + file_util::AppendToPath(&key_path, L"key_file.exe"); + + wchar_t exe_full_path_str[MAX_PATH]; + ::GetModuleFileNameW(NULL, exe_full_path_str, MAX_PATH); + std::wstring exe_full_path(exe_full_path_str); + + file_util::CopyFile(exe_full_path, key_path); + ASSERT_TRUE(file_util::PathExists(key_path)); + + LOG(INFO) << "copy ourself from " << exe_full_path << " to " << key_path; + + // Run the key path file to keep it in use. + STARTUPINFOW si = {sizeof(si)}; + PROCESS_INFORMATION pi = {0}; + ASSERT_TRUE( + ::CreateProcessW(NULL, const_cast<wchar_t*>(key_path.c_str()), + NULL, NULL, FALSE, CREATE_NO_WINDOW | CREATE_SUSPENDED, + NULL, NULL, &si, &pi)); + + // test Do(). + { + scoped_ptr<DeleteTreeWorkItem> work_item( + WorkItem::CreateDeleteTreeWorkItem(dir_name_delete, key_path)); + + // delete should fail as file in use. + EXPECT_FALSE(work_item->Do()); + } + + // verify everything is still there. + EXPECT_TRUE(file_util::PathExists(key_path)); + EXPECT_TRUE(file_util::PathExists(file_name_delete_1)); + EXPECT_TRUE(file_util::PathExists(file_name_delete_2)); + + TerminateProcess(pi.hProcess, 0); + // make sure the handle is closed. + WaitForSingleObject(pi.hProcess, INFINITE); +} |
